Abstract:

Nanocrystalline boron doped tin oxide and boron and silver co-doped SnO۲ was successfully prepared by using simple sol-gel method. The structural property of as-prepared nanocrystalline materials was investigated by using X-ray powder diffraction, Raman spectroscopy, Fourier transform infrared spectroscopy and scanning electron microscopy. The infrared spectra of the prepared samples showed an incorporation of B and Ag in the SnO۲ nanocrystals. The X-ray powder diffraction pattern of the as prepared sample demonstrated the formation of a rutile structure of SnO۲ nanocrystallites with particle size of ۳۵ nm and ۹۸ nm for boron doped and co-doped samples respectively. The two different Sn-O bond distances are found to be varying in a different manner for the doped samples unlike pristine samples. A significant lattice microstrain was observed for co-doped samples indicating local lattice distortion. The prepared samples showed significant anti-microbial activities against some Gram-Positive & Gram-Negative bacteria in both water and DMSO medium. The prepared materials can be effective for water remediation.
